I'm About 28 weeks preg. with twins not alowed vag. sex any more just woundering if anal sex would be o.k.

Nallie answered Monday February 27 2006, 11:09 pm:
Hello,

I am not sure what type of complications you've had, but a large number of twin pregnancies are high risk. I would say it would not be worth the risk. The reproductive organs sit in close proximity to the lower bowel, and since you are over halfway through your pregnancy your enlarged uterus is subject to trauma from anal sex..which may in turn stimulate contractions or bleeding.

Although not satisfying to you I would suggest other things to stimulate and satisfy your partner.

While this subject seems quite embarrasing to discuss with your Dr. I think it's a very good question. Best wishes to you and your babies.
